Pear Trixzie ‘Pyvert’ Dwarf – Freshly Potted*
A dwarf, upright deciduous fruiting tree which is self-pollinating. Pear Trixzie Pyvert produces dense branching with elliptic deep green leaves which change colour in Autumn. Will require annual pruning once the foliage has dropped in Winter. This will encourage a stronger branching framework, airflow through the canopy and better fruit quality. Produces medium obovate-pyriform fruit with green skin. The flesh is a cream-white colour with a juicy smooth texture. Ideal for eating fresh, cooking, drying or preserving. This is an ideal tree for large gardens, food gardens or as a feature tree. Grows best in humus-rich soil which is well-draining.
Flesh: Cream to white
Skin: Green
Cropping: High
Fruit Maturity: March – April
Suitable Pollinators: Self Pollinating
Position: Full Sun
Height: 1.5 m
Width: 1.5 m
